Eugene Tome

February 17, 1933 — June 16, 2023

Eugene (Gene) Francis Tome passed away on Friday June 16, 2023 due to complications from Parkinson’s Disease.  He was born in 1933 in Erie, PA to Ora and Eleanor Tome and graduated from Millcreek High School.  He married his high school sweetheart Carole Ruth Gilmore in 1953.  He served in the US Army from 1953-55 and then was employed by The Retail Credit Company, subsequently Equifax, as an insurance investigator in the Meadville area.  After retiring, he continued working part-time at Hanna’s Hardware in Townville.  Gene and Carole, along with a few friends and family, built their dream retirement home on a secluded property near Cambridge Springs where they spent many hours tending their garden, gathering firewood and enjoying life in the woods.  Gene led a life of service, serving as a deacon and choir member at First Presbyterian Church of Meadville, treasurer of the Meadville Lions Club, president of the Saegertown Lions Club, Exulted Ruler of the Meadville Benevolent Order of Elks, and a board member of the Bethesda Children’s Home. He also served on the Penncrest school board and enjoyed singing with the Wesbury Barbershoppers. He and Carole adopted Gravel Run Road where they collected trash for over 20 years.

Gene and Carole raised two sons, Michael and Tracy, and imparted their love of the outdoors to them through many camping trips, hikes, and canoe paddles.

He is survived by his loving wife, Carole; two sons, Michael and his wife, Karin (Becker) and Tracy and his wife, Suzie (Peterson); grandchildren Jesse, Ethan, Jacob, Eli, and Samuel;  his brother, Ronald and wife, Sharon (McCormick) and numerous nephews, nieces and cousins.

Gene was preceded in death by his parents; an infant brother, Gerald; two younger brothers, John and Robert and a sister, Lois (Tome) Cermack.
